The 3323 Variable Filter is a solid state, variable dual-channel electronic filter that is digitally tuned over the range from 0.01Hz to 99.9kHz. It can be operated in High-Pass, Low-Pass, Band-Pass or Band-Reject mode. It has an attenuation slope of 48 dB per octave in High-Pass or Low-Pass mode, 24db per octave in Band-Pass or Band-Reject mode. The frequency response characteristic of the unit is a fourth-order Butterworth with maximum flatness for cleanest filtering in the frequency domain. For pulse or transient signal filtering, a front panel switch is provided to change the frequency response to RC optimum for transient-free filtering. Frequency Accuracy: ?2% Pass Band Gain: 0 dB or 20 dB Maximum Attenuation: 80 dB Floating (ungrounded) Operation.
